WALTER D'SOUZA A.I.C.E.D.C. VICE PRESIDENT 

Mangaloe, October 10: Famous Puttur D'Souza Brothers' Walter D'Souza elected as a vice-president for All India Cashew Export Development Corporation's during their 46th annual meeting at Cochin, Kerala. Majority of the cashews from India is exported from Kerala state. This is the first time a person Karnataka state grabbed this high ranking position. Mangalore Cashew Producers Association's past president Walter D'Souza, worked as appoinement directed member in New Mangalore Port. Currently Walter D'Souza is the president of Kanara Industrial and
Handicraft Association's Export & Import Committee. Since 15 years he scored first rank in exporting cashew nut oil in Karnataka. 

"KONKANN BAL 2001" 

Mangalore, October 10: Christian Life Community of Anjelore Church, Mangalore conducted "Konkann Bal 2001" competition at the Don Bosco
Hall for children ages between 3 and 5. Winners were: I Vinol Roche, Anjelore, II Andrea D'Souza, Milagrese and III Ashlita Pinto, Derebail.
During this event Mangalore Corporation's Vice Mayor Lancelot Pinto was honoured. Corporator Smt. Jacintha Alfred released Sri. V.V.'s first
Kokani audio cassette.

WILFY REBIMBUS HONOURED BY KONKANNI KUTAMB-BAHRAIN
 
"Konkani Kutamb" Bahrain was privileged to have the presence of veteran &
prominent composer & singer Sri Wilfy Rebimbus & his wife Meena Rebimbus as
the guests to grace the occasion on 5th October 2001 in Karnataka Social Club
premises accompanied by galaxy of Konkani artists & singers, Prem, Dolla,
Claude, Vishwas & Sandria.
"Konkani Kutamb" complimented in admiration the profound & dedicated service
attributed by Wilfy Rebimbus to Konkani language. Wherever he lands, that land
becomes rich with Konkani music & culture. Exemplary theme is the integral
hallmark of his melodious songs.
A memento was presented in honour of him.

TWO KONKANS ELECTED AS MANGALORE STOCK EXCHANGE OFFICERS

Mangalore: Sri K. Devananda Pai has been elected as a president of Mangalore Stock Exchange for year 2001-2002 on October 7th.  Sri. Ivan Eugene Lobo elected as the Treasurer.  Both were elected unanimously for the board by the members.  Sri Devananda Pai is a member of Stock Exchange since 1994.  He was the president in 1997-1999 and last year he worked as a Director.  Well famous for his leadership and charitable work, Sri Devanand is also a president of Canara High School Old Students' Association, Urwa, Mangalore.  He is a businessman who is actively participating in several community organization.  Since last five years Sri Ivan worked as a Treasurer of Mangalore Stock Exchange.  He is a member of Stock Exchange since seven years.  He is well experienced in 'Investment Management and Treasury Operations'.  He worked in several national and international organizations as prominent roll.
